Services we handle
Water damage restoration, Whether it’s a burst pipe, appliance failure, or stormwater intrusion, standing water and hidden moisture need to be extracted and dried before secondary damage sets in. Wet materials that feel dry at the surface can still hold enough moisture in the substrate to feed mold within days.
Fire and smoke damage restoration, Smoke residue is acidic and keeps corroding surfaces long after the fire is out. Restoration involves removing charred materials, neutralizing odor at the source, and cleaning or replacing structural components that absorbed soot.
Mold remediation, Florida’s humidity gives mold a head start. Remediation goes beyond surface cleaning, it means containing the affected area, removing colonized materials, and addressing the moisture source so the problem doesn’t return behind a freshly painted wall.
Reconstruction, After damage is mitigated, the structure still needs to be put back together. From framing and drywall to flooring and finishes, reconstruction brings a property back to livable condition under one contractor rather than requiring homeowners to coordinate multiple trades.
